Produktinformationen zu „Audit Risk Alert (ePub)“
This book focuses on areas of change in audits performed under the Uniform Guidance, highlighting those areas which may be challenging or frequently misunderstood. It also discusses emerging practice issues and current developments related to entities subject to an audit performed under Government Auditing Standards and the OMB Uniform Guidance, and provides information to help you identify significant risks that may affect an audit of entities receiving federal awards. In addition, this alert provides a summary of proposed revisions to Government Auditing Standards as found in the exposure draft to assist you in keeping up to date on the proposed revisions to the Yellow Book.
Autoren-Porträt von Aicpa
Founded in 1887, the American Institute of Certified Public Accountants (AICPA) represents the CPA and accounting profession nationally and globally regarding rule-making and standard-setting, and serves as an advocate before legislative bodies, public interest groups and other professional organizations. The AICPA develops standards for audits of private companies and other services by CPAs; provides educational guidance materials to its members; develops and grades the Uniform CPA Examination; and monitors and enforces compliance with the accounting profession's technical and ethical standards.The AICPA's founding established accountancy as a profession distinguished by rigorous educational requirements, high professional standards, a strict code of professional ethics, a licensing status and a commitment to serving the public interest.
